Keto Halloween Peanut Butter Cup Cookies Ingredients
1 cup of creamy peanut butter
1/4 cup monk fruit blend sweetener
2 tablespoons golden monk fruit
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 egg
15 sugar-free peanut butter cups
1/3 cup sugar-free chocolate chips, melted
Keto Halloween Peanut Butter Cup Cookies Directions
-
Preheat oven
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
-
Get a medium bowl
Beat together peanut butter, sweeteners and salt in a medium bowl.
-
Mix in vanilla & egg
Mix in vanilla and egg until combined.
-
Pinch & roll dough
Pinch off some cookie dough and roll it into a 1 inch ball. Place on a parchment lined baking tray.
-
Make dough balls
Press sugar-free peanut butter cup into each dough ball. Repeat with remaining dough.
-
Bake it
Bake at 350 degrees for 7 minutes. Remove from oven and cool in the refrigerator for 15 minutes.
-
Piping bag time
Add melted sugar-free chocolate chips to a piping bag. Pie spide legs and top with candy eyes.
-
Zombie cake
To make zombie cookie, add a few drops of green food coloring to melted sugar-free white chocolate chips. Pipe zombie hair and mouth.

These keto cookies are for my peanut butter and chocolate fans. The cookie base is a keto peanut butter cookie, which surrounds a creamy, sugar-free peanut butter cup.
Decorate these keto halloween cookies as spiders or zombies. Both are fun options that everyone will enjoy – especially if you are serving them at a Halloween party!
ChocZero has three different varieties of low carb peanut butter cups – dark chocolate, milk chocolate and white chocolate. For this halloween keto peanut butter cup cookie recipe, I used all three flavors. I used the sugar-free dark and milk chocolate peanut butter cups to make the spider cookies. I used the white chocolate keto peanut butter cups to make the zombie cookies.
